Inhoud: The nationalisation of the British fire service in 1941 has conventionally been interpreted as an administrative revolution by contemporaries and historians alike. The destructive ferocity of the Blitz, particularly its concentration on London and major provincial cities, was indeed the catalyst for major restructuring, highlighting serious inadequacies in the effectiveness of local fire protection. However, the decision taken by Herbert Morrison, the home secretary, was founded on reforms implemented on an ad hoc basis since the mid-1930s. Like other areas of civil defence, reform was piecemeal and the result of increasing co-ordination by policy-makers and professional stakeholders. This paper explores those reforms, arguing that nationalisation was a staging post in the evolution of the fire service from a heterogeneous collection of fire brigades to a co-ordinated system of fire defence.
